Technical Specifications

Chemical Formula: HgCl₂
CAS Number: 7487-94-7
Concentration (Assay): ≥99.5% (AR Grade)
Physical State: White crystalline powder
Molecular Weight: 271.52 g/mol
Density (20°C): 5.44 g/cm³
Melting Point: 276°C
Solubility in Water: 7.4 g/100mL (20°C)
Loss on Drying: ≤0.5%
Insoluble Matter: ≤0.005%
Sulfates (SO₄): ≤0.001%
Other Heavy Metals: ≤0.001%
Storage Temperature: Room temperature
Packaging Options: 25g, 100g, 500g bottles

Safety Information

EXTREMELY TOXIC mercury compound. Fatal if swallowed, inhaled, or absorbed through skin. Handle only in well-ventilated areas with appropriate protective equipment including chemical-resistant gloves, safety goggles, and respiratory protection. Ensure proper waste disposal according to hazardous material regulations.

Storage & Handling

Store in original containers in a cool, dry, well-ventilated area in locked poison cabinet. Keep containers tightly closed and protect from light. Use only with extreme caution and appropriate safety protocols for mercury compounds.

Chemical Mechanisms & Reaction Pathways

Mercuric chloride exhibits strong Lewis acid properties and forms stable coordination complexes through multiple reaction pathways, enabling precise analytical applications including protein precipitation and electrochemical analysis.

Lewis Acid Behavior

HgCl₂ acts as electron pair acceptor forming coordination compounds

Essential for complexometric analysis
Protein Precipitation

Mercury-sulfur bond formation with cysteine residues

Selective protein analysis methods
Redox Reactions

Hg²⁺/Hg⁰ redox couple for electroanalytical applications

Controlled electrochemical analysis
Halide Complexation

Formation of [HgCl₄]²⁻ and other chloro-complexes

Analytical separation mechanisms
